dc.description.abstractMonoterpenes are renewable raw material. They can be used in the pharmaceutical, cosmetic and food industries as active components of drugs and ingredients of fragrances. Alkoxylation reactions of terpenes are important routes to obtain compounds with high commercial value. Traditionally, homogeneous acid catalysts (sulfuric acid) have been used in these reactions. However, these homogenous catalysts have some disadvantages such as, its separation from reaction mixture, they cannot be reused. The solid acids have many advantages over liquid acids. They do less harm to the environment and do not have corrosion or effluent disposal problems. They are reusable and easy to be separated from liquid products. This review focuses on alkoxylation of terpenes over heterogeneous catalysts.por
